如何快速在Excel中识别异常值?如何准确处理这些异常值?
作者:佚名|分类:EXCEL|浏览:59|发布时间:2025-04-02 20:40:52
如何在Excel中快速识别异常值?如何准确处理这些异常值?
在数据分析和处理过程中,异常值(Outliers)是那些偏离数据集整体趋势的数据点。它们可能是由于错误、异常情况或数据收集过程中的问题造成的。识别和处理异常值对于确保数据分析的准确性和可靠性至关重要。以下是如何在Excel中快速识别异常值以及如何准确处理这些异常值的详细步骤。
如何快速在Excel中识别异常值
1. 使用描述性统计
首先,可以通过计算数据的描述性统计量来初步识别异常值。在Excel中,可以使用“数据分析”工具包中的“描述统计”功能。
打开Excel,选择“数据”选项卡。
在“分析”组中,点击“数据分析”。
在弹出的“数据分析”对话框中,选择“描述统计”。
在“输入区域”中,选择包含数据的单元格范围。
在“输出区域”中,指定一个位置来放置统计结果。
选择“标志最大最小值”,这样在输出结果中会显示最大值和最小值。
点击“确定”。
通过观察最大值和最小值,可以初步判断是否存在异常值。
2. 使用图表
使用图表是识别异常值的一种直观方法。
选择包含数据的列。
点击“插入”选项卡。
选择合适的图表类型,如散点图或箱线图。
在散点图中,异常值通常表现为远离其他数据点的点。
在箱线图中,异常值通常表现为超出箱线外的点。
3. 使用公式
Excel中的一些公式可以帮助识别异常值。
Z-分数:计算每个数据点的Z-分数,即数据点与平均值的标准差数。通常,Z-分数绝对值大于3的数据点可以被认为是异常值。
```excel
=STDEVP(A:A) 计算A列的标准差
=AVERAGE(A:A) 计算A列的平均值
```
IF和STDEV.P:结合使用IF和STDEV.P函数可以识别Z-分数大于3的数据点。
```excel
=IF(ABS((A2-AVERAGE(A:A))/STDEVP(A:A))>3, "异常值", "正常值")
```
如何准确处理这些异常值
1. 分析原因
在处理异常值之前,首先要分析异常值产生的原因。这可能涉及检查数据收集过程、检查数据输入是否有误等。
2. 决定处理方法
根据异常值的原因,可以采取以下几种处理方法:
删除异常值:如果异常值是由于错误或异常情况造成的,可以将其删除。
修正异常值:如果异常值是由于数据收集过程中的问题造成的,可以尝试修正这些值。
保留异常值:在某些情况下,异常值可能包含有价值的信息,可以保留。
3. 应用处理方法
在Excel中,可以使用以下方法来处理异常值:
删除异常值:直接删除包含异常值的行或单元格。
修正异常值:使用公式或函数来修正异常值。
保留异常值:不做任何操作,保留异常值进行分析。
相关问答
1. 为什么需要识别和处理异常值?
异常值可能会扭曲数据分析的结果,导致错误的结论。因此,识别和处理异常值对于确保数据分析的准确性和可靠性至关重要。
2. 如何确定一个数据点是否是异常值?
通常,可以通过计算Z-分数、使用箱线图或散点图来识别异常值。如果数据点的Z-分数绝对值大于3,或者它位于箱线图的外部,那么它可以被认为是异常值。
3. 处理异常值后,应该如何验证分析结果?
在处理异常值后,应该重新进行数据分析,并与其他数据源或方法进行比较,以确保处理后的结果更加准确。
4. Excel中是否有自动识别和处理异常值的工具?
Excel没有专门的工具来自动识别和处理异常值,但可以通过使用公式、函数和图表来实现这一目的。
通过以上步骤,您可以在Excel中快速识别异常值,并准确处理这些异常值,从而提高数据分析的准确性和可靠性。